Hi
I took my Sidebar folder from my Vista x64 DVD iso, to Server 2008 X64 and registered the "dll's" and sidebar.exe" everything works fine, except for the clock and few other gadgets dont show properly. My main concern is the clock, it shows all black..
Does anybody know how to fix this.. i have seen people using sidebar on server x64 (some other sites), with clock showing normal the way its on vista..
please help me here

Thank you

Edit: Fixed now, i was running the commands using "regsrv" it should be "regserver"

you must register the dlls, the converter tool will do it or you can do it manually

# regsvr32 sbdrop.dll
regsvr32 wlsrvc.dll
# From that same console run:
sidebar /RegServer
# Move the Sidebar registry information from a working Vista SP1 x64 install. You can find it at HKLM/Software/Microsoft/Windows/CurrentVersion/SideBar.
# Run sidebar!
